Survival tips - Ten tips to protect food suppliesQuite a few people are currently considering putting away sustenance for crises however feel they have snags that keep them from doing as such. Maybe they feel they don’t have any free space, or get to be overpowered by the undertaking.

Having restricted space and living in a hot sticky atmosphere for no less than 120 days out of the year, I am extremely acquainted with capacity issues.

Preferably, sustenance ought to be put away at around 50-55 degrees, without any that 15% dampness. Does that mean you can’t store food in the event that you don’t have these perfect conditions? Obviously you can! The conditions depicted are “ideally” sort situation, and we all know it’s not impeccable, else we would not have to store sustenance.

Summer temperatures in California achieve more than 90 degrees with 70% stickiness. To spare power, we keep the aerating and cooling at around 68-70 degrees. The A/C eliminates dampness, however dampness still leaks in. This is something we can’t overlook. We simply consider that the nourishment put away won’t keep going the length of it would have at cooler, drier temperatures.

Here are a few tips:

  • Clear out a section before obtaining started, or as you provide grows. Clean out the junk closet and sell or present things, leaving free area for food storage. Attempt exploitation below utilized areas like under the beds, within empty suitcases or TV cupboard.
  • Keep away from waste and store just sustenances that you’re family eats. Fight the temptation to stock up marked down or stopped things simply due to the low cost.
  • Pick canned food that have the longest close dates. Try not to purchase jars that are scratched or distorted regardless of the fact that they are vigorously marked down. Albeit a few studies have indicated they can last a couple of years past their termination dates, I lean toward not to hazard it, particularly after a companion’s heartbreaking knowledge. Getting sick from eating ruined sustenance is not justified, despite all the trouble.
  • Turn your food always. I stamp the lapse date with a Sharpie marker on top of the canned food and on the sides to verify I utilize them before those dates. At any rate twice per year, experience your supplies and utilization anything near termination.
  • On the off chance that you are putting away mass food in mylar packs, watch the correct strategy by utilizing oxygen safeguards and letting all the freshen up. Mark your cans with the substance and the date the food was put away. Arrangement on utilizing these put away food inside of five years, rather than ten, if your capacity conditions are not perfect.
  • Figure out that irritations got into your put away sustenance, for example, rice or flour would be tragic, also costly to supplant. Clean the zone encompassing your sustenance stockpiling altogether. Verify the range is dry and vermin free. For extra security from bugs, keep put away foods in five gallon sustenance evaluation containers with tight tops.
  • For most extreme time span of usability, pick dried out or solidify dried sustenances. Mountain House, a supplier of sustenance for recreational and crisis purposes, simply expanded their expressed timeframe of realistic usability from 10 years to 12 years on their pockets.
  • On the off chance that you are putting away water in holders for drinking, utilize and supplant the water following a year. Mark the date of capacity on the compartment utilizing a name or sharpie marker. Mold or greenery may create after the holder been sitting in a warm, damp region for some time. If you do use water that has been stored for a long while, have a backup water purification system by running it through a filter, boiling etc.
  • Bottled water does last past their expiration dates, depending on the storage location.
  • Make beyond any doubt your food and water stockpiling is not near fuel or different chemicals that transmit exhaust that will taint your supplie.

These tips will help minimize mistakes, and guarantee your put away sustenance and water will be accessible when you most need them.
